Output d855d756d59b9558d6ec461b79f5fa66853a70f92ea4f834b9a611cfc5e56368:5

value
10417751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b60119d49c11709aef2ab85e09c1c142c93cfa22 OP_EQUAL
address
3JHNDwyzNcFAb1ssHdcdb94SQmodgQmJKj
transaction
d855d756d59b9558d6ec461b79f5fa66853a70f92ea4f834b9a611cfc5e56368
confirmations
354862
spent
true